Slab Contrasted Ondi 3 is a very bold, narrow, medium contrast, upright, tall x-height font visually similar to 'Old Wood JNL' by Jeff Levine (names referenced only for comparison).

A dense, heavy display serif with chunky slab terminals and subtly bracketed joins. Strokes are strongly weighted with noticeable internal contrast created by counters and cut-ins rather than delicate hairlines. The design uses squared-off geometry, rounded corners in key curves, and distinctive notches/ink-trap-like bites where strokes meet, giving letters a carved, stamped feel. Proportions are compact and horizontally tight, with sturdy bowls and a high, prominent lowercase presence that keeps text looking solid at headline sizes.

Best suited for posters, headlines, branding marks, and packaging where a bold, vintage voice is desired. It performs especially well in short phrases, titles, and sign-like layouts where its notched detailing can become part of the visual identity. For longer text, it will be most effective at large sizes with generous spacing to keep the shapes from crowding.

The overall tone feels Western and theatrical, evoking vintage wood type, saloon posters, and circus playbills. Its bold mass and cut-in details add a rugged, handcrafted energy that reads as confident, loud, and a bit nostalgic.

Likely designed as a high-impact display face that channels classic slab-serif wood type while adding distinctive cut-in detailing for texture and memorability. The goal appears to be strong presence at a distance and a recognizable, themed personality for editorial and promotional work.

The uppercase set leans toward monumental, billboard-ready shapes with strong vertical emphasis, while the lowercase maintains similarly heavy weight and simplified forms. Numerals are equally blocky and attention-grabbing, designed to hold up in short bursts rather than quiet running text. The repeated interior notches across multiple glyphs create a consistent brand-like texture when set in words.
